- Description
- Focus on interpretation and analysis of oral readings of literature as a creative and analytical way to examine the human condition, liberation, resistance, and social change. Through selecting, reading, analyzing, and interpreting culturally diverse literature (poetry, short stories, prose, and drama), students will better understand and be able to critique the structural, aesthetic, and ethical components of narrative and performance.
